Default Dryer heat intermittent
Brand: Roper
Model Number: RGS7745PQ0
Age: 1 - 4 years

On both timed-dry and auto-sense, dryer ignitor glows, then dims. Flame only appears 20% of the time.
Timer on auto-sense side never moves. Replaced Timer, no change.
Vent clear of lint.
